""A Catholic's View on Indulgences"" by Reverend Hugh P. Smyth is a book that explores the concept of indulgences in the Catholic Church. The author provides an in-depth analysis of the history and theology behind indulgences, as well as their significance in the life of a Catholic believer. The book also addresses common misconceptions about indulgences and offers practical advice on how to obtain them. Written in a clear and accessible style, this book is an essential resource for anyone seeking to deepen their understanding of Catholic teachings on indulgences.
